Abstract

The purpose of this study is to clarify the characteristics and utilization of the plan of temporary child protection centers, and to grasp the evaluation by users. In the analysis, the characteristics of the floor planning and the trend of the area composition in the facilities in the local area were grasped. Through the evaluation of the living environment, it was clarified that the bedroom serves as a base for children to calm down and to have private conversation with staff. On the other hand, children are forced to spend time in limited space and daily routine.
